Berrange */ #include #include "libvirt-gconfig/libvirt-gconfig.h" #include "libvirt-gconfig/libvirt-gconfig-private.h" #define GVIR_CONFIG_STORAGE_VOL_GET_PRIVATE(obj) \ (G_TYPE_INSTANCE_GET_PRIVATE((obj), GVIR_CONFIG_TYPE_STORAGE_VOL, GVirConfigStorageVolPrivate)) struct _GVirConfigStorageVolPrivate { gboolean unused; }; G_DEFINE_TYPE_WITH_PRIVATE(GVirConfigStorageVol, gvir_config_storage_vol, GVIR_CONFIG_TYPE_OBJECT); static void gvir_config_storage_vol_class_init(GVirConfigStorageVolClass *klass G_GNUC_UNUSED) { } static void gvir_config_storage_vol_init(GVirConfigStorageVol *vol) { vol->priv = GVIR_CONFIG_STORAGE_VOL_GET_PRIVATE(vol); } GVirConfigStorageVol *gvir_config_storage_vol_new(void) { GVirConfigObject *object; object = gvir_config_object_new(GVIR_CONFIG_TYPE_STORAGE_VOL, "volume", DATADIR "/libvirt/schemas/storage_vol.rng"); return GVIR_CONFIG_STORAGE_VOL(object); } GVirConfigStorageVol *gvir_config_storage_vol_new_from_xml(const gchar *xml, GError **error) { GVirConfigObject *object; object = gvir_config_object_new_from_xml(GVIR_CONFIG_TYPE_STORAGE_VOL, "volume", DATADIR "/libvirt/schemas/storage_vol.rng", xml, error); return GVIR_CONFIG_STORAGE_VOL(object); } /** * gvir_config_storage_vol_set_name: * @name: (allow-none): */ void gvir_config_storage_vol_set_name(GVirConfigStorageVol *vol, const char *name) { g_return_if_fail(GVIR_CONFIG_IS_STORAGE_VOL(vol)); gvir_config_object_set_node_content(GVIR_CONFIG_OBJECT(vol), "name", name); } void gvir_config_storage_vol_set_capacity(GVirConfigStorageVol *vol, guint64 capacity) { g_return_if_fail(GVIR_CONFIG_IS_STORAGE_VOL(vol)); gvir_config_object_set_node_content_uint64(GVIR_CONFIG_OBJECT(vol), "capacity", capacity); } void gvir_config_storage_vol_set_allocation(GVirConfigStorageVol *vol, guint64 allocation) { g_return_if_fail(GVIR_CONFIG_IS_STORAGE_VOL(vol)); gvir_config_object_set_node_content_uint64(GVIR_CONFIG_OBJECT(vol), "allocation", allocation); } /** * gvir_config_storage_vol_set_target: * @target: (allow-none): */ void gvir_config_storage_vol_set_target(GVirConfigStorageVol *vol, GVirConfigStorageVolTarget *target) { g_return_if_fail(GVIR_CONFIG_IS_STORAGE_VOL(vol)); g_return_if_fail(target == NULL || GVIR_CONFIG_IS_STORAGE_VOL_TARGET(target)); gvir_config_object_attach_replace(GVIR_CONFIG_OBJECT(vol), "target", GVIR_CONFIG_OBJECT(target)); } /** * gvir_config_storage_vol_set_backing_store: * @backing_store: (allow-none): */ void gvir_config_storage_vol_set_backing_store(GVirConfigStorageVol *vol, GVirConfigStorageVolBackingStore *backing_store) { g_return_if_fail(GVIR_CONFIG_IS_STORAGE_VOL(vol)); g_return_if_fail(backing_store == NULL || GVIR_CONFIG_IS_STORAGE_VOL_BACKING_STORE(backing_store)); gvir_config_object_attach_replace(GVIR_CONFIG_OBJECT(vol), "backingStore", GVIR_CONFIG_OBJECT(backing_store)); }
